Dès 1976, Françoise Dolto connaît un immense succès grâce à son émission quotidienne sur France Inter, "Lorsque l'enfant paraît ". Elle répond à des lettres de parents en difficulté face à l'éducation de leur enfant. Sans prétendre donner des recettes, elle définit une attitude : chercher les raisons de chaque problème rencontré et y répondre avec la justesse que l'attitude psychanalytique lui permet.

Françoise Dolto was a French pediatrician and psychoanalyst, famous for her research on babies and childhood. Dolto revolutionized the field of psycho-therapeutic work with babies (notably in their early experience and usage of language through their body), with the mother-baby dyad, and with a more positive observation and understanding of the means of communication used by children with learning or social disabilities.

She worked with Jacques Lacan, and said that children have a language before the language (with the body). She has contributed to the question of the unconscious body image, and influenced among others the work of Maud Mannoni.

As a recognized feminist, she also worked on reconciling women with their sexuality; she also analyzed the attitude of children when their parents are separating or divorcing.

Françoise Dolto was the mother of Carlos (1943–2008), a singer; and the sister of Jacques Marette, a minister.

Книгата е пълна с опасни и ненаучно подкрепени твърдения, които противоречат на здравия разум. Част от съветите не само че са нелогични, но биха могли да бъдат направо вредни за развитието на детето. Един от най-шокиращите примери е препоръката, ако детето започне да псува, бащата да го научи на още псувни и дори как се изписват. Подобни „съвети“ нямат място в литература, която претендира да е полезна за родители.

this is an edited transcript of a French radio show on child psychology hosted by a psychoanalyst. i find the listeners submitted questions quite interesting and weirdly feel slightly less intimidated by kids after reading
